Thick-cut pork chops stuffed with a savory mixture of pecans, herbs, and breadcrumbs, then pan-seared and oven-finished.

  • 4 bone-in pork chops, 1-inch thick
  • 1 cup finely chopped pecans
  • 1/2 cup fresh breadcrumbs
  • 2 tablespoons fresh sage,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on fresh thyme,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 3 tablespoons butter, divided
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  1. 1

    Preheat oven to 375°F. Cut a deep horizontal pocket in each pork chop.

  2. 2

    Melt 1 tablespoon butter in a skillet. Sauté garlic for 30 seconds, then stir in pecans, breadcrumbs, sage, and thyme. Cook 2 minutes until fragrant.

  3. 3

    Season pork chops with salt and pepper. Stuff each pocket with the pecan mixture and secure with toothpicks.

  4. 4

    Heat olive oil and remaining butter in an oven-safe skillet over medium-high heat. Sear chops for 3 minutes per side.

  5. 5

    Transfer the skillet to the oven and bake for 20 to 25 minutes until the internal temperature reaches 145°F.

  6. 6

    Rest for 5 minutes before serving. Remove toothpicks.
